Knies Pushes Through Knee Injury, Drives Leafs' Playoff Push

Published 3 weeks, 6 days ago
Description

Matthew Knies, a Toronto Maple Leafs forward, is battling a persistent knee injury, but remains determined to play, even as the team faces a wave of injuries. Despite the injury, Knies has shown growth, posting 57 points in 66 games, and has stepped up as a leader, filling more minutes on the top lines. The Leafs, with Knies grit, are fighting to secure a playoff spot amidst defensive struggles.
